XML DOM replaceData() 方法

定義和用法

replaceData() 方法替換文本節點中的數據。

語法:

replaceData(start,length,string)
參數 描述
start 必需。規定在何處替換字符。開始值以 0 開始。
length 必需。規定替換多少個字符。
string 必需。規定插入的字符串。

實例

在所有的例子中,我們將使用 XML 文件 books.xml,以及 JavaScript 函數 loadXMLDoc()

下面的代碼片段用 "Easy" 替換 <title> 元素的文本節點的前 8 個字符:

xmlDoc=loadXMLDoc("books.xml");
x=xmlDoc.getElementsByTagName("title")[0].childNodes[0];
x.replaceData(0,8,"Easy");
document.write(x.nodeValue);

輸出:

Easy Italian

相關頁面

XML DOM 參考手冊:CharacterData.replaceData()